Well I don't have an answer for you but here's what I found:

  1. If I tried the form on your page, I got the time out error instantly after submitting
  2. I tried the form from the url of the iframe http://pacwestindustries.com/ifp/embed.php?id=2 and it worked just fine.

My suggestion is to give that information to the Instant form pro people and see if they can see what on your page might be causing an issue.
